Analysis

Burkina Faso recorded 43.9% for proportion of women aged 15-49 years with anaemia, non-pregnant in 2023.

That represents a change of up 1.6% on the previous year and down 3.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, proportion of women aged 15-49 years with anaemia, non-pregnant in Burkina Faso peaked at 55.6% in 2000 and was at its lowest, 43.1%, in 2020.

Burkina Faso ranks 19th of 209 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 24 years of available data.

Proportion of women aged 15-49 years with anaemia, non-pregnant in Burkina Faso, year by year

Annual values for Proportion of women aged 15-49 years with anaemia, non-pregnant (%) in Burkina Faso, 2000 to 2023.
Year Value Change
2000 55.6%
2001 54.9% -1.3%
2002 54.2% -1.3%
2003 53.5% -1.3%
2004 52.8% -1.3%
2005 52.0% -1.5%
2006 51.2% -1.5%
2007 50.4% -1.6%
2008 49.4% -2.0%
2009 48.5% -1.8%
2010 47.6% -1.9%
2011 46.8% -1.7%
2012 46.2% -1.3%
2013 45.6% -1.3%
2014 45.2% -0.9%
2015 44.9% -0.7%
2016 44.3% -1.3%
2017 43.8% -1.1%
2018 43.5% -0.7%
2019 43.3% -0.5%
2020 43.1% -0.5%
2021 43.1% +0.0%
2022 43.2% +0.2%
2023 43.9% +1.6%
